Gray Instant, 2020. Monoprint on cotton paper, 76 x 50 cm. - With each gray overlay, the drawing is transformed and appears in a different way. The work seeks an equivalence between layers of gray and layers of time, where the absence of color speaks of the present time, and the deepest black exists as the most distant memory, or vice versa. It is also an experience about repetition and difference. An accumulation of the same minimal gesture, of the same gray overlays, of the same spiral instants, and of the same and different monotypes.
